6 CHILTON WAY is a very small semi-detached house of 71m², built sometime between 1930 and 1949, which could now be worth an estimated £289,349. It was last sold for £207,500 in July 2015, which was around 1% below the average July 2015 semi-detached price in the Dover local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was June 2015, where the current energy rating was E, and the potential energy rating was B.

What might 6 CHILTON WAY be worth now?

6 CHILTON WAY might now be worth an estimated £289,349.

This is based on house price inflation of 39.4%, between July 2015 and May 2026, for semi-detached houses, in the Dover local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 39.4%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 6 CHILTON WAY of £207,500 on 9th July 2015. For the value to have increased from £207,500 to £289,349 over the eleven years and two months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 6 CHILTON WAY has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Dover local authority area.
  • The July 2015 sale price of £207,500 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 6 CHILTON WAY has not materially changed since July 2015.
